Transaction cbfac9481cce38bc8f1477c7a1433d7bdb671d6ab74d0fa16d0efff64b309356
1 Input
1 Output
-
cbfac9481cce38bc8f1477c7a1433d7bdb671d6ab74d0fa16d0efff64b309356:0
- value
- 3451810
- script pubkey
- OP_0 OP_PUSHBYTES_20 966e44e7f81f68e6b5aaa5a1d4c5f12e91bfa03d
- address
- bc1qjehyfelcra5wddd25ksaf30396gmlgpaf5nyct